    I recently lowered the handIebars on my cb750 to clip ons and the throttle is sticking. think I've got the adjuster tightened as far as it'll go both at the lever and at the carbs and It's still sticking.

  • @thedutchmanandthedigger1500
    @thedutchmanandthedigger15008 ай бұрын

    Disconnect both cables from the throttle barrel and see if the function properly. If they do and the barrel spins free on the bar end. The cables need slack in some way. You can always remove the reputable and run a pull cable only. Just make sure the return spring definitely functions.

    I got this issue , but I can't do what you suggested because I only have one nut on the end of the throttle cable and the pull cable 2019 bike , so I can't adjust it , I changed my bars but went back to stock and still have the problem

  • @thedutchmanandthedigger1500
    @thedutchmanandthedigger150010 ай бұрын

    If you have 2 throttle cables, you can eliminate the return cable and use only the pull cable. This can be done for diagnosis as well as permanent. If you run it permanently just make sure the return spring system is working properly. If the pull cable shielding or throttle barrel is damaged, the throttle will not return. These steps and option will help diagnose additional problems.

    THANK YOU! I wish this video would show up higher in the search instead of all the clickbait videos that show up first. This video really helped me. I have a 1979 CX500 Custom I’ve rebuilt. It’s always had the stickiest, gummy throttle. I’d gotten used to it, figuring it was just “vintage bike” feel. After watching this video, I removed the cables and really cleaned them. Lubed them, cleaned and lubed the throttle sleeve, adjusted the length. It’s like night and day! The throttle is so much smoother. It snaps back. The bike feels so much more responsive. I’m amazed at how much better it feels to ride it. I know the cables don’t affect how the bike runs, but it honestly feels like the bike runs way better than before. I suppose that’s because the carbs are reacting to much more subtle flicks of my wrist instead of having the wrestle the throttle to get it to react. Thank you!
